    Just fitted some new middleburn X type cranks and came across a very odd problem.

    It’s as if the axle is too short. When you try to tighten down the fixing bolt the BB goes tight before the crank bottoms out on the spline. I disassembled everything, it was all put together properly. Adjusting collar fully back against NDS crank, spline tight on DS, correct spacers on Chris King BB, frame exactly 73mm wide shell etc… Eventually gave up and removed the 2.5mm spacer from the BB and replaced with a 1mm spacer and it worked perfectly as per instructions. Seems the BB has some tolerance which is lucky. Must be a Friday pm set that bypassed QC at Middleburn.

    Couldn’t find anything else like this online so thought I’d post this in case others have this problem.
